Tornado activity:

Shenandoah-area historical tornado activity is above Texas state average. It is 159%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 11/21/1992, a category F4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 32.8 miles away from the Shenandoah city center injured 16 people and caused between $50,000,000 and $500,000,000 in damages.

On 12/12/1968, a category F3 (max. wind speeds 158-206 mph) tornado 9.8 miles away from the city center ca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.

Natural disasters:

The number of natural disasters in Montgomery County (21) is a lot greater than the US average (12).
Major Disasters (Presidential) Declared: 11
Emergencies Declared: 9

Causes of natural disasters: Floods: 8, Storms: 8, Hurricanes: 7, Fires: 5, Tornadoes: 4, Other: 1 (Note: Some incidents may be assigned to more than one category).
